CVE-2026-49223
Vvveb CMS (versions before 1.0.8.4) has an authorization bypass in admin/sql/sqlite/product_review.sql, which accepts a caller-controlled product_review_id without verifying ownership against the current admin's admin_id. CVE-2017-7312
An issue was discovered in Personify360 e-Business 7.5.2 through 7.6.1. When going to the /TabId/275 URI, anyone can add a vendor account or read existing vendor account data including usernames and passwords...
